#cfe6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cfe6ee is composed of 81.2% red, 90.2%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 195.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 87.3%. #cfe6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9fcddd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#cfe6ee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cfe6ee has RGB values of R:207, G:230,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 13625070.

Shades and Tints of #cfe6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080a is the darkest color, while #fafdfd is the lightest one.
